Ex-Cowboys receiver Patrick Crayton is in a war of words with his new coach in San Diego.

Crayton, who was traded by the Cowboys just before the season, blasted his Chargers' special teams unit for not taking their jobs seriously.

The Seahawks' Leon Washington ran back two kicks (101 and 99 yards) for touchdowns to help Seattle upset the the Chargers 27-20 on Sunday.

"Right now, (special teams) coach (Steve) Crosby is (ticked) off. I don't blame him," Crayton said after the game. "The guys who are sitting in the meetings are not taking him seriously when he tells you to do a certain thing on a kickoff. He's been in this league I don't know how many years. He's been around a while for a reason, obviously. You have to take this stuff seriously."

Responding to the critical comments, San Diego head coach Norv Turner told Crayton to stifle himself.

"Patrick is new to our organization," Turner said on Monday. "And I don't think you'll hear any other comments about it from Patrick. He knows now that the way we handle things is in-house."

Turner has reportedly met with the veteran receiver. "I think Patrick understands I am the spokesman in terms of how we're handling things," Turner said on Monday.

It's been a great week for Dallas receiver Roy Williams.

He had his best statistical day as a member of the Cowboys on Sunday, then he got revenge on rookie wideout Dez Bryant for that whole pads-carrying train...p incident.

At the time, Williams said it was no big deal if Bryant just took the team out to dinner. So Bryant ultimately offered to bring the offense to Pappas Bros. Steakhouse on Monday night, according to Calvin Watkins of ESPNDallas.com.

Williams decided to invite the defense as well. With all the extra mouths to feed and some take home bottles of wine, the bill came to $54,896.

"They got the young fella," Bryant's adviser David Wells said. "What could he say? He had to pay it unless he wanted to wash dishes for a month."

Wells clearly hasn't washed dishes before. At minimum wage salary in Texas and 40 hours a week, Bryant would be working until 2014 at least to pay that tab off.
